Output 6578341205db82c557e09a4a31965f620f4d593785245ea7057781eaff8c687a:5

value
59256637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ac00d906c0c3afa8db240f9d74b42b3dfe2fe96 OP_EQUAL
address
M8t14RXzrzZCeXfC8JjjwQqVZhYAcsRUoK
transaction
6578341205db82c557e09a4a31965f620f4d593785245ea7057781eaff8c687a
spent
true